Community Translation - Porting an Application from ModusToolbox 1.0 to version 1.1 - KBA226484

Tip / Sign in to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
keni_4440091
Level 7
Level 7
500 replies posted 100 solutions authored 50 solutions authored

Hi

I want to translate KBA226484, please confirm to my work.

Regards,

Nino

0 Likes
2 Replies
JennaJo
Moderator
Moderator
Moderator
1000 replies posted 750 replies posted 500 replies posted

Hi, Nino-san

Confirm to work this KBA.

Thanks

Jenna

Jenna Jo
0 Likes

タイトル:ModusToolbox 1.0からバージョン1.1のアプリケーションの移植

バージョン 7

chaitanyav_41 2019/02/26 0:02 に作成。ChaitanyaV_61 2020/05/16 8:52 に変更。

Author: JamesT_21   Version: *A

この記事は今では使用されません
ModusToolbox™
ソフトウェアは、以前のバージョンとは異なるバージョン2.xに移動しました。 ModusToolbox 2.xへの移行に関するガイダンスについては、ModusToolbox V1.1 からV2.Xへの移行 - KBA229043 を参照して下さい。 PSoC®Creator™またはModusToolbox 1.0プロジェクトがある場合は、ModusToolbox v2.xに直接移行する必要があります。

質問:

ModusToolboxMT)バージョン1.0から1.1へのアプリケーションの移行の仕方

回答:

プロジェクト構造は、ユーザー経験を向上させるためにこれらのバージョン間で根本的に変更されました。更に、SDKの多くのリソースも更新されました。結果として、バージョン1.0から1.1へアプリケーションを移植する簡単な方法はありません。

下記のように、プロセスを可能な限りスムースにすることができます。

  1. ModusToolbox IDEバージョン1.1を開き、新しいアプリケーションを作成します。必要なものに一番近い開始のアプリケーションを使用します。例えば、EmptyPSoC6App。これで新しいプロジェクト構造と互換性のあるアプリケーションを作成されます。
  2. Eclipsワークスペース内の)新しいアプリケーションのdesign.modusファイルを1.0アプリケーションのdesign.modusファイルに置き換えます。
  3. MT 1.1デバイスコンフィギュレータを使用してdesign.modusファイルを開きます。

複数のワーニングとタスクが表示される可能性があります。これは想定される事です。

pastedImage_7.png

   4.  デバイスコンフィギュレータのバージョン1.1のライブラリを使用するためdesign.modusファイルを更新します、File > Update Referenced
Libraries
を使用します。psoc6sw 1.1ライブラリを選択します。

pastedImage_18.png

    5  オリジナルプロジェクトにマッチするように新しいプロジェクトを変更します。

例えば、オリジナルのmain.cファイルを使用します。ミドルウェアまたは独自のソースコードを追加した可能性があります。マッチするようにMT 1.1プロジェクトを更新します。

変更したシンボル名や、他のビルド問題が発生する可能性がありますが、MT 1.1のアプリケーションに移行するためには、これらのステップで長い道のりとなります。

注意 もし、アプリケーションがCM0+ CPUで記述されたカスタムコードであるなら、CM4 CPUに機能を移すべきです。CM0+プロジェクトはMT 1.1では簡単に有効にはなりません。CM0+は、サイプレスまたはそのパートナーによって提供されるシステム機能用の予備とすべきです。新しいプロジェクト構成では、デフォルトCM0+のビルドはCM4プロジェクトに含まれます。

262 閲覧 カテゴリ: Software: PSoC Software  タグ: version, porting, modustoolbox

0 Likes